5 Steps in Writing an Ownership Transfer Letter Step 1: Communicate with the Recipient of the Property Legalities. ... Step 2: Reach an Agreement with the Recipient. ... Step 3: Use Readable Fonts When Writing the Data. ... Step 4: Include All Necessary Details about the Transfer. ... Step 5: Review the Letter before Affixing the Signature.
An ownership transfer letter can be written in the following way: Explain the purpose of the transfer request letter. Consider the overall position of the asset. Mention how the transfer will be of mutual benefit. Ensure the clarity of pints. Mention details of who is involved. Terms, conditions, and legal obligations.

A letter of transfer of ownership is a formal notice or request to transfer property, asset, or rights from one party to another. It is often used in combination with a transfer agreement to authenticate the transaction and protect both parties involved.
